Art Blakey
, leader of the highly influential hard-bop group
The Jazz Messengers
(which was usually a quintet or a sextet), made a rare tour with an 11-piece little big band in mid-1980. Included among the personnel were such unknown youngsters as trumpeter
Wynton Marsalis
(then age 18),
Branford Marsalis
on baritone and alto, trombonist
Robin Eubanks
and guitarist
Kevin Eubanks
. The remarkable group also included the regular members of
(trumpeter
Valeri Ponomarev
, altoist
Bobby Watson
, tenor saxophonist
Billy Pierce
and pianist
James Williams
) and even a second drummer,
John Ramsey
. The music (three
compositions, the standard
"Stairway to the Stars"
and
Williams
's blues "Minor Thesis") is consistently excellent and all of the musicians get their chance to solo. A historically significant and rather enjoyable release. ~ Scott Yanow
